Output 20538603b361e4b05a020a7978e07270589399201a9a0c23ea9be382f785bf15:3

value
24761719
script pubkey
OP_0 OP_PUSHBYTES_32 ed223b3bc7796d3e6fd578064dfc83fe8fa4df9cba822bd8a6ee4cbfd344256b
address
bc1qa53rkw7809knum740qrymlyrl686fhuuh2pzhk9xaextl56yy44sc2h70z
transaction
20538603b361e4b05a020a7978e07270589399201a9a0c23ea9be382f785bf15
spent
true